Short Guide to Trust, Transparency and Brand Safety
Introduction In recent years, trust among the general population has taken a hit. The rise of fake news, along with high-profile data breaches and some inappropriately placed programmatic ads have eroded the trust that people and organisations have in the businesses they work with. In 2017, marketing consultancy firm Edelman confirmed this sentiment, declaring in […]